Features:
Fully polished, precision machined and heat treated chrome vanadium steel is the perfect combination for hardness and torque ability for heavy duty work while being able to easily be wiped clean. Chrome Moly internal gearing material.
Specialized tear drop, pear head design features 100 tooth mechanism for efficiency, strength and durability with only a 3.6 degree swing per revolution. Get the job done faster in tight spaces.
Fast one finger touch flip switch serves the forward and reverse function to maneuver direction of socket turn to forward or reverse when tightening or loosening fasteners in tight spaces with the flip of your thumb.
The ball detent feature locks your socket in so it won't fall out when in use. One touch button at head of drive secures socket into place and quickly releases without hassle to loosen or tighten.
Versatile drive body is 8-inches long with an ergonomic contoured grip for comfort and pairs well for home maintenance and car or truck repair while reducing hand fatigue and slippage.

I have a full neiko set. really great sockets. This ratchet is nice, never skips a tooth, but has one critical flaw. When using a loose-hand/fast ratcheting technique, even slightly bumping the direction selector locks up the mechanism. Anyone else have that issue?
